Output 6da4b79120d3265e1991f05097b5b536dc3f7fa9f2076e00864837aade0aa0f8:0

value
2582629273
script pubkey
OP_0 OP_PUSHBYTES_20 cdbc02aad984aa206a8bf320be229388a6455b34
address
tb1qek7q92kesj4zq65t7vstug5n3zny2ke5vgcs0a
transaction
6da4b79120d3265e1991f05097b5b536dc3f7fa9f2076e00864837aade0aa0f8
confirmations
66680
spent
true